8 Photos from a trip to The Old Manse in Concord 9.10.22
I visited The Old Manse today. This is a house built in 1770 for Ralph Waldo Emerson’s grandfather, William Emerson. Emerson and Hawthorne both lived there for short periods of time in the 1830s and 1840s. All the photos are mine. The words are mostly by Hawthorne. The Old Manse on 09.10.2022.
